Page 6: Brown Bag on Quality Matters

QM Rubric Eight General Standards:

1. Course Overview and Introduction2. Learning Objectives 3. Assessment and Measurement4. Resources and Materials5. Learner Interaction6. Course Technology7. Learner Support8. Accessibility

Key components must align.

Alignment: Critical course elements work together to ensure that students achieve the desired learning outcomes.

Page 8: Brown Bag on Quality Matters

Rubric Scoring

Standards Points Relative Value

17 3 Essential

11 2 Very Important

12 1 Important

TOTALS

40 85

Team of 3 reviewers initially score individually One score per standard based on team majority Pre-assigned point value Yes/No decision; All/None points Consensus is NOT required

Page 9: Brown Bag on Quality Matters

For QM Purposes, Quality Is…

• More than average; more than “good enough”

• An attempt to capture what’s expected in an effective online course at about an 85% level

• Based on research and widely accepted standards

85 %

Page 10: Brown Bag on Quality Matters

To Meet Expectations…

A course must achieve:

• “Yes” on all 17 of the 3-point “essential” standards.

• A minimum of 72 out of 85 points

72/85 = 85%

Page 12: Brown Bag on Quality Matters

Factors Affecting Course Quality

• Course design QM REVIEWS THIS

• Course delivery (i.e. teaching, faculty performance)

• Course content• Course management system• Institutional infrastructure• Faculty training and readiness• Student engagement and readiness
